Wallaroo
Brooklyn, US · Founded 2015 · 34 employees on LinkedIn · 8 known investors
Wallaroo.AI offers a unified platform for deploying, serving, monitoring, and optimizing machine learning and AI models in production across cloud, on-premise, and edge environments. It targets enterprise AI teams working with a range of models—from traditional ML to LLMs and computer vision—across industries such as manufacturing, retail, life sciences, defense, and financial services.
Founders & leadership
Wallaroo was founded in 2015 by Vidyut Jain.

- Who are Wallaroo's investors?
- Wallaroo's investors include boldstart ventures, Contour Venture Partners, Four Acres Capital, M12 (Microsoft's Venture Fund), MyAsiaVC, Resolute Ventures, Sierra Ventures, Supernode Ventures.
- How much funding has Wallaroo raised?
- Wallaroo has disclosed $35M raised across 7 rounds.
